Sounds like a relay issue or maybe even a harness plug has come undone. I ran into this problem a while back with my RX7 and found a small plug under the kick panel had worked itself loose by about 1/16th of an inch. Plugged it back in and didn't have the problem again...thanks to mr. ziptie.
